Abstract
The present invention relates to a computer system and method for promoting on-line activities on desired sites via a virtual entertainment system that provides games, interactions or activities that take place either partially or fully on the partner'"'"'s website or within the virtual space associated with the partner'"'"'s website. According to one aspect, the invention drives on-line traffic to partner sites using Virtual Collectibles and other prizes rewarded for participation in Internet-based games. The games are designed to promote users to visit and/or perform other activities on the partner sites, and can include giveaways, special offers, treasure hunts, combo puzzles, among many other types of games. According to other aspects, the games can be played by users in the course of, or with very little effort in addition to casually surfing the web.
